Marwick Cottage is a beautifully presented one-bedroom home offering contemporary living in a thoughtfully designed layout. The open-plan kitchen and living area has been finished with modern fittings and clean, crisp lines, creating a welcoming space that is ideal for both everyday living and relaxed entertaining. Large glazed doors draw in natural light and open directly onto the private, decked terrace; an attractive extension of the living space and a perfect spot for morning coffee or evening dining.

The bedroom is a calm and comfortable retreat, complete with an ensuite bathroom finished to a high standard. Step-free access throughout adds to the ease and convenience of the home, while on-street parking is available on the Maidenhead Road (not on the gravelled driveway).

Set within a peaceful pocket of Dedworth, Marwick Cottage offers an inviting blend of comfort, practicality, and style. It's self-contained layout, contemporary décor, and private outdoor space make it an ideal choice for buyers seeking an easy-to-maintain home close to the amenities and attractions of Windsor.

Situated in Dedworth, the cottage enjoys a wide selection of local shops and services, with Windsor’s vibrant centre just moments away. Its renowned array of restaurants, cafés, boutiques, and cultural attractions, including Windsor Racecourse and Windsor Marina, and home to the popular Go-Go’s restaurant, are within easy reach. Two nearby train stations provide links to London Paddington (via Slough on the Elizabeth line) and Waterloo, offering journeys into central London in under an hour. Excellent road connections include the M4, giving swift access to Heathrow Airport and the wider motorway network.
